Detroit Police honor long-time Detective Ira Todd

The Detroit Police Department bid farewell to Detective Ira Todd, who announced he is retiring after nearly 35 years of service. During the years he served the people of Detroit, he won numerous awards including Chief’s Unit and Merit. Detective Todd is most proud of the more than 100 confessions he got from homicide suspects and serial robbers, including suspects who shot and killed fellow officers.
